European Commission opens in-depth investigation into Danish scheme in wastewater treatment sector

30/01/26 (Agence Europe)On Friday, 30 January, the European Commission announced the that it had opened an in-depth investigation into a Danish scheme in the wastewater treatment sector with the aim of examining whether companies that use a lot of water have an undue advantage in breach of the European Union’s State aid rules. Since 2013, Denmark has applied a degressive charge for wastewater treatment that is based on the volume of wastewater discharged (‘staircase model’), which enables companies discharging large volumes of wastewater to pay a lower average charge per m3 than that paid by companies discharging smaller quantities. In April 2024, the EU’s General Court had annulled a 2018 Commission decision (C(2018)2259) (see EUROPE 12005/27) that the ‘staircase model’ did not constitute State aid (Case T-486/18). The latter will investigate in order to evaluate the economic rationality of introducing the disputed model as well as assess the selective nature of this model. (MB)
